How we collect and use (process) your personal information

Proxis collects personal information about its website visitors and customers. With a few exceptions, this information is generally limited to:

  • Name
  • Job title
  • Work address
  • Work email
  • Work email inbox
  • Work phone number

We do not sell personal information to anyone and only share it with third parties who are facilitating the delivery of our services. We use this information to provide prospects and customers with services.

From time to time, Proxis receives personal information about individuals from third parties. Typically, information collected from third parties will include further details on your employer or industry. We may also collect your personal data from a third party website (e.g. LinkedIn).

Important: User data attained from Google Workspace APIs are not used to develop, improve, or train generalized AI and/or ML models.

Use of the Proxis Website

Like most websites, Proxis's site automatically collects and logs certain information. This may include your IP address, your general geographical location, the type of browser and operating system you're using, and other details about your usage of our website, such as your browsing history. We use this data to tailor our site to better meet the needs of our users.

Proxis has a valid interest in understanding how its website is used by members, customers, and potential customers. This helps Proxis to offer more relevant products and services, communicate effectively with our sponsors and corporate members, and ensure adequate staffing to meet the needs of our members and customers.

Sharing information with third parties

Your personal information that Proxis collects is stored in one or more databases managed by third-party providers based in the United States. These third-party providers are not permitted to access or use your personal data for any purpose other than cloud storage and retrieval.

We do not disclose your personal data to non-Proxis individuals or businesses for their separate use unless: (1) you give consent or request it; (2) it is related to Proxis-hosted or Proxis co-sponsored conferences; (3) the information is needed to comply with legal obligations; (4) the information is given to our agents, vendors or service providers who carry out functions on our behalf; (5) to address emergencies or acts of God; or (6) to address disputes, claims, or to individuals demonstrating legal authority to act on your behalf.

Transferring personal data to the U.S.

Proxis is based in the United States and all data we gather about you will be managed within this jurisdiction. By utilizing Proxis's services, you acknowledge that your personal data will be handled in the United States.

Under Article 46 of the GDPR, Proxis ensures proper safeguards by adopting binding, standard data protection clauses, which are enforceable by data subjects in the EEA and the UK. Since its establishment, Proxis has not received any government requests for information.

Data storage and retention

Proxis stores your personal information on its own servers and those of its cloud-based database management service providers, all located within the United States. We keep service data for the duration of our business relationship with customers and for a certain period thereafter.

Any personal data controlled by Proxis can be deleted upon a verified request from Data Subjects or their authorized representatives. For further details, please contact us at support@proxis.ai.

Data Protection Mechanisms for Sensitive Data

We protect sensitive data through a combination of technical and organizational measures. All data is encrypted both at rest and in transit using industry-standard protocols. Access to sensitive information is tightly controlled based on the principle of least privilege, with role-based access control (RBAC) in place.

We follow a policy of data minimization, collecting and retaining only the information necessary for our stated purposes. Additionally, all employees with access to sensitive information undergo regular training on data protection best practices and incident response protocols.
